ARCADIA MILLS v. BANKERS' TRUST CO.

No. 3514.

68 F.2d 323 (1934)

ARCADIA MILLS v. BANKERS' TRUST CO.

Circuit Court of Appeals, Fourth Circuit.

January 4, 1934.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

C. E. Daniel and L. W. Perrin, both of Spartanburg, S. C. (Perrin & Tinsley and Lyles & Daniel, all of Spartanburg, S. C., on the brief), for appellant.

David Paine, of New York City (White & Case, of New York City, and Wilton H. Earle, B. F. Martin, and Price & Poag, all of Greenville, S. C., on the brief), for appellee.

Before PARKER, NORTHCOTT, and SOPER, Circuit Judges.


NORTHCOTT, Circuit Judge.

This is an action at law brought in September, 1931, in the District Court of the United States for the Western District of South Carolina by the appellee, Bankers' Trust Company, a New York banking corporation, herein referred to as the bank, against appellant, Arcadia Mills, a South Carolina textile corporation, herein referred to as the mills, on the latter's five promissory notes, payable to the bank, aggregating $220,000.
